Why Correct Sealant Materials Last While Duct Tape Fails in Lightstreet, PA

Standard duct tape uses a rubber-based adhesive that performs at room temperature but dries and loses adhesion when repeatedly exposed to the temperature extremes that duct systems experience during HVAC operation in Lightstreet. A supply duct carrying cold conditioned air through a 130-degree summer attic cycles through extreme temperatures with every cooling cycle in Lightstreet, PA. Standard duct tape adhesive is not formulated for this cycling and fails within a few seasons in Lightstreet. Mastic sealant remains flexible after curing and maintains its seal through years of thermal cycling in Lightstreet, PA. UL 181-rated foil tape maintains adhesion for 20 years or more in normal duct system conditions in Lightstreet.

Where Leaks Occur

Where Duct Leaks Occur and Why They Develop in Lightstreet, PA

At Every Unsealed Duct Joint Throughout the System in Lightstreet

Every connection between duct sections is a potential leak point in Lightstreet, PA. In most residential installations, these joints were mechanically fastened without sealant during installation in Lightstreet. Over years of thermal cycling that expands and contracts the ductwork with every HVAC cycle, even joints that were initially sealed with standard duct tape have failed as the tape dried and lost adhesion in Lightstreet, PA.

At Branch Takeoffs From the Main Trunk Line in Lightstreet, PA

Branch takeoffs split conditioned air from the main trunk line into the individual branch runs serving each room in Lightstreet. They have multiple edges and angles that create significant potential leak area if not correctly sealed in Lightstreet, PA. Branch takeoff leaks are among the largest individual leak points in typical residential duct systems in Lightstreet.

At Register Boot Connections in Walls and Ceilings in Lightstreet

The register boot connects the branch duct run to the wall, ceiling, or floor opening where the supply register mounts in Lightstreet, PA. The connection between the flexible duct and the boot collar and the connection between the boot and the surrounding framing are both common significant leak points in Lightstreet. Conditioned air escaping at the boot level leaks into the wall or ceiling cavity rather than through the register into the room in Lightstreet, PA.

Why Original Installation Sealant Fails Over Time in Lightstreet, PA

Systems sealed with standard duct tape develop leakage as the tape dries, cracks, and loses adhesion from temperature cycling in Lightstreet. Standard duct tape on duct joints typically fails within three to five seasons of thermal cycling in Lightstreet, PA. Joints that were sealed with standard tape appear sealed when first applied and are open to leakage again within a few years in Lightstreet.

How Leaking Ducts Create Comfort Problems Room by Room in Lightstreet, PA

Supply duct leakage between the trunk line and the registers means rooms furthest from the air handler receive less conditioned air than they were designed to receive in Lightstreet. The conditioned air that leaks out before reaching the register does not reach the room in Lightstreet, PA. Rooms at the end of long duct runs with multiple leak points along the way receive the cumulative effect of all those leaks in Lightstreet. The room that is always too hot in summer and too cold in winter is often at the end of a duct run with multiple unsealed joints in Lightstreet, PA.

What Return Duct Leaks Do to Your Indoor Air Quality in Lightstreet, PA

Return duct leaks draw air from the surrounding unconditioned space into the return airstream in Lightstreet. A return duct leak in an attic draws hot, dusty attic air into the air handler in summer in Lightstreet, PA. A return duct leak in a crawl space draws crawl space air including moisture, mold spores, and soil particulate into the system in Lightstreet. This unconditioned air bypasses the filter and is distributed throughout the home in Lightstreet, PA.

What MBM Uses to Seal Duct Leaks in Lightstreet, PA

Mastic Sealant — The Professional Standard in Lightstreet

Mastic is a water-based sealant specifically formulated for duct system applications in Lightstreet, PA. It remains flexible after curing, maintaining its seal through the thermal cycling that duct systems experience in Lightstreet. It does not dry out, crack, or lose adhesion from temperature cycling the way standard duct tape does in Lightstreet, PA.

UL 181-Rated Foil Tape for Specific Applications in Lightstreet, PA

UL 181-rated foil tape is tested and rated specifically for HVAC duct applications in Lightstreet. Unlike standard duct tape, it maintains its adhesion through the temperature cycling of duct system operation in Lightstreet, PA. Appropriate for specific sheet metal seam applications in Lightstreet.

Standard Duct Tape Is Never Used in Lightstreet

Standard silver duct tape is not rated for duct system applications in Lightstreet, PA. Its rubber-based adhesive dries and loses adhesion from temperature cycling in Lightstreet. MBM Air Duct Cleaning never uses standard duct tape for duct sealing work in Lightstreet, PA.
